On Mar 29, 2012, at 2:40 PM, John Mousel wrote:

> I'm attempting to solve a non-symmetric discretization of a 3D Poisson 
> problem. The problem is singular. I've attached the results of KSPView from 
> runs with ML and GAMG. When I run ML, I get convergence in 30 iterations. 
> When I attempt to use the same settings with GAMG, I'm not getting 
> convergence at all. The two things I notice are:
> 
> 1. GAMG is using KSPType preonly, even though I've set it to be Richardson in 
> my command line options.

PETSc seems to switch the coarse grid solver to GMRES in Setup.  This seems to 
be a bug and I unwisely decide to override this manually. I will undo this in 
the next checkin.  This should not be the problem however.

> 2. ML only coarsens down to 4 rows while GAMG coarsens to 2. My problem is 
> singular, and whenever I try to use LU, I get zero pivot problems. To 
> mitigate this, I've been using Richardson with SOR on the coarse matrix. 
> Could the smaller coarse grid size of GAMG be causing problems with SOR. If 
> so, is there a way to put a lower limit on the coarse grid size?
> 

I'm thinking that with a 2x2 coarse grid 8 iterations of SOR is picking up the 
null space.  Maybe try just one SOR iteration on the coarse grid.

Also, can you run with options_left so that I can see your arguments.  One 
known bug is the mat_diagaonal_scale breaks GAMG, but it should also break ML.
